The Kenora District Camp Owners Association is working on educating American visitors on Canada’s Border Entry Rules.

Tourism groups want the Canadian Border Services Agency to better communicate

enforcement rules dealing with old driving under the influence records.

President Harald Lohn says last year 12 of his American

visitors never made it to his Ear Falls camp due to DUI’S.

Lohn says so far, none of his visitors this year have

been turned away at the Fort Frances border crossing.
